Bulk Loading

8x faster

Use native bulk load utilities for maximum throughput

Implementation Steps:

  1. 1Export data in native bulk format
  2. 2Disable indexes and constraints temporarily
  3. 3Use database-specific bulk loaders
  4. 4Batch commits for optimal performance
  5. 5Rebuild indexes after load completion

Incremental Migration

3x faster

Migrate historical data separately from active data

Implementation Steps:

  1. 1Identify data access patterns and age
  2. 2Migrate recent/active data first
  3. 3Move historical data in background
  4. 4Use change data capture for ongoing sync
  5. 5Validate incrementally as you go
